Texans' Keke Coutee (hamstring) practices on Wednesday
Houston Texans wide receiver Keke Coutee (hamstring) was a limited participant in Wednesday's practice.
The Texans rookie receiver was able to practice in limited fashion on Wednesday after missing Week 8's game against the Miami Dolphins with a hamstring injury. Even after acquiring Demaryius Thomas, Coutee should still play a key role as the slot receiver for the Houston offense.
If Coutee is active this week against the Denver Broncos, our models project him for 25.9 receiving yards on 2.1 receptions.
